What is Pea Protein Concentrate?
Pea protein concentrate is derived from yellow peas, also known as Pisum sativum. It is a highly concentrated form of protein obtained by extracting and isolating the protein from the peas. The process involves removing the starch and fiber content, resulting in a protein-rich powder.
Pea protein concentrate typically contains around 80% protein, making it a valuable source of essential amino acids. It is also low in fat and carbohydrates, making it suitable for individuals following a low-calorie or low-carbohydrate diet.
Nutritional Benefits of Pea Protein Concentrate
Pea protein concentrate offers several nutritional benefits that make it an attractive choice for health-conscious individuals:
- High Protein Content: Pea protein concentrate is rich in protein, providing all nine essential amino acids necessary for muscle growth and repair.
- Easy Digestion: Unlike some other plant-based proteins, such as soy or wheat, pea protein concentrate is easily digestible and does not cause digestive discomfort or bloating.
- Hypoallergenic: Pea protein concentrate is hypoallergenic, making it suitable for individuals with allergies or sensitivities to common allergens like dairy, soy, or gluten.
- Rich in Branched-Chain Amino Acids (BCAAs): BCAAs play a crucial role in muscle protein synthesis and are essential for athletes and individuals engaged in regular physical activity.
- Cholesterol-Free: Pea protein concentrate is naturally cholesterol-free, making it a heart-healthy protein option.
Applications of Pea Protein Concentrate
Pea protein concentrate has a wide range of applications across various industries:
Food and Beverage Industry
Pea protein concentrate is commonly used in the food and beverage industry as an ingredient in plant-based products. It serves as a suitable replacement for animal-based proteins, such as whey or casein, in products like protein bars, shakes, and plant-based meat alternatives. Its neutral taste and smooth texture make it an ideal choice for enhancing the nutritional profile of these products without compromising on taste.
Sports Nutrition
Athletes and fitness enthusiasts often turn to pea protein concentrate as a post-workout recovery supplement. Its high protein content and BCAA profile aid in muscle repair and growth. Additionally, pea protein concentrate is easily digestible, allowing for quick absorption and utilization by the body.
Dietary Supplements
Pea protein concentrate is a popular ingredient in dietary supplements, particularly those targeted towards individuals with specific dietary restrictions or preferences. It provides a convenient and versatile protein source for individuals following vegan, vegetarian, or gluten-free diets.
Weight Management
Due to its low-calorie and low-carbohydrate content, pea protein concentrate is often incorporated into weight management products. It helps promote satiety and supports lean muscle mass, making it an effective component of weight loss or weight maintenance programs.
Why Choose Pea Protein Concentrate?
There are several reasons why pea protein concentrate is a viable choice for individuals seeking a high-quality protein source:
- Sustainability: Pea protein concentrate is derived from yellow peas, which are a sustainable crop. Peas require less water and fertilizer compared to other protein sources like soy or animal-based proteins.
- Environmental Impact: The production of pea protein concentrate generates fewer greenhouse gas emissions compared to animal-based protein sources. Choosing pea protein concentrate contributes to a lower carbon footprint.
- Allergen-Free: Pea protein concentrate is free from common allergens like dairy, soy, and gluten, making it suitable for individuals with food allergies or intolerances.
- Versatility: Pea protein concentrate can be easily incorporated into a variety of recipes and products, thanks to its neutral taste and smooth texture. It blends well with other ingredients, making it a versatile protein option.
